The core concept of the video – unearthing hidden elements – directly aligns with the Silent Hill ethos. The series is renowned for its intricate world-building and subtle narrative cues. Think of the cryptic messages etched into walls, the symbolic monster designs, or the recurring motifs that hint at the characters’ inner turmoil. “Easter eggs” in Silent Hill aren’t just cute nods to pop culture; they are often integral pieces of the lore, providing deeper understanding and context to the psychological landscapes players traverse.
Applying this to Silent Hill f, which is set in 1960s Japan and boasts a distinct visual style with floral and folkloric undertones, the potential for unique and deeply embedded Easter eggs is immense. We’ve already seen glimpses of this in the trailers, with unsettling imagery of blooming flowers that morph into something monstrous, and the unsettling presence of what appears to be a supernatural entity entangled with the protagonist. These aren’t just aesthetic choices; they are fertile ground for the developers to seed hidden meanings and foreshadowing.
